What are I:Moves?
What are I:Moves? • I:Moves are simple and practical steps to
express God’s love unto others.
The Heartbeat of I:Moves
The Heartbeat of I:Moves Matt 2237 Jesus said to him, “‘You shall love the LORD
your God with all your heart, with all your soul, and with all your mind.’ 38 This is the first and great commandment. 39 And the second is like it: ‘You shall love your neighbor as yourself.’ 40 On these two commandments hang all the Law and the Prophets.”
The Heartbeat of I:Moves Matt 28:19-2019 Go therefore and make disciples of all the
nations, baptizing them in the name of the Father and of the Son and of the Holy Spirit, 20 teaching them to observe all things that I have commanded you; and lo, I am with you always, even to the end of the age.” Amen.
